Acquiring an Apostille for Documents from Yerington

Yerington dwellers needing to confirm their documents for international use can obtain an apostille through the Nevada Secretary of State's office. An Apostille Carson City apostille is a official seal that confirms the genuineness of a document issued by a government agency in Yerington. To receive an apostille, documents must be adequately signed and submitted to the Nevada Secretary of State's office along with the necessary application and fees.

  • Critical considerations when applying for an apostille include:
  • Record type and intent
  • Country where the document will be used
  • Turnaround time and fees

Visit the Nevada Secretary of State's website for detailed information on apostille procedures and submit your application online or by mail.
